Analysis

In 2025, completion rate, upper secondary education, female (modelled data) in United States of America stood at 94.5%.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.

That represents a change of up 0.1% on the previous year and up 1.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, completion rate, upper secondary education, female (modelled data) in United States of America peaked at 94.5%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 88.9%, in 1996.

That places United States of America 20th out of 164 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 45 years of available data.
